Now that we’re past Halloween, let’s turn our attention to Thanksgiving and, of course, kitchens. Here’s a new design that’s well prepared to handle the chaos of a big holiday dinner.

On the exterior, bold modern farmhouse styling is still very much on trend. The garage is located in the back, so the front stays focused on neighborhood-friendly curb appeal.

Inside, a flex room near the front can become a home office or a hobby space across from the primary suite. The living and dining areas flow into the main kitchen. But behind the kitchen there’s a surprise—a prep space (call it a messy kitchen) with a sink, a pantry, cubbies, and a desk.

Upstairs, two more bedrooms and a loft await visitors or family members.
